PRE-9/11 TERRORIST' MAIL CAME FROM INDY
By MURRAY WEISS
November 1, 2001
--
EXCLUSIVE Threatening letters mailed to the
media before the World Trade Center attacks - bearing striking
similarities to the current anthrax-tainted letters - were mailed
from Indianapolis, where the deadly bacteria was discovered
yesterday, The Post has learned.
The pre-Sept. 11 letters were addressed in block letters that
virtually match the lettering on the anthrax-laced missives sent to
Sen. Thomas Daschle, the New York Post and NBC, law-enforcement
sources said.
One source allowed The Post to see copies of envelopes from several
of the earlier letters.
Each line of the printed address clearly sloped downward to the right
and the handwriting eerily resembled that on the anthrax letters.
Federal investigators checked the return addresses on the letters,
the sources said, but none of them was real.
The return address on one letter - addressed to Fox News Channel's
Bill O'Reilly - listed the name of Sean Hannity, another FNC
personality.
Despite the obvious twisted humor, that letter and about 15 more now are a major focus
of the far-flung federal probe, the sources say.
The similarities between the pre-Sept. 11 and post-Twin Tower disaster letters has
further fueled a theory at the FBI and Justice Department that the anthrax scare is
the work of a twisted home-grown menace rather than a
terrorist linked to state-sponsored action or Osama bin Laden.
Source say investigators are eyeing a number of groups, including radical members of a
pagan cult.
The Wiccan group fashions itself as modern-day witches seeking religious freedom, but
they are not known to be violent.
Investigators are probing whether a disturbed member of the group may have taken a
bizarre turn and is targeting the media and the government in particular.
Indiana officials yesterday said that it was a coincidence they tested for - and found
- traces of anthrax in a facility that repairs parts from sorting machines used by the
U.S. Postal Service.
Inspectors initially started testing for the deadly bacteria in another repair
facility, in Topeka, Kan., after several workers experienced flu-like symptoms, said
Darla Stafford, spokeswoman for the Greater Indianapolis
post office.
She said inspectors then tested in Indianapolis as a precaution
because parts from an anthrax-affected post office in Washington,
D.C. were recently repaired there.
